  • What are the best products for decomposition odor removal?

    For professional-grade decomposition odor removal, a combination of specialized products is often required, moving beyond typical household cleaners. Enzymatic cleaners are paramount for initial cleanup, as they contain enzymes that break down organic matter, effectively eliminating the source of the odor. Brands like BioKleen Bac-Out or professional enzyme digesters are highly effective. For surface cleaning, hospital-grade disinfectants with strong virucidal and bactericidal properties are essential to not only clean but also sanitize the area, preventing the growth of odor-causing microorganisms. After initial cleaning, odor neutralizers are crucial. These products dont just mask odors but chemically alter or encapsulate the odor molecules. Look for industrial-strength formulations. For pervasive airborne odors, ozone generators are incredibly effective as they produce ozone (O3), which oxidizes and destroys odor molecules. However, these must be used with extreme caution in unoccupied spaces due to ozones respiratory hazards. Hydroxyl generators offer a safer alternative for occupied spaces, as they produce hydroxyl radicals that mimic natural outdoor deodorization processes. Activated charcoal can be used in bowls or sachets to absorb residual odors in the air. For odors absorbed into porous materials like subflooring or drywall, professional-grade encapsulation primers or sealers are often applied after cleaning and before new finishes to prevent the odor from off-gassing into the air. Companies like Kilz offer heavy-duty odor-blocking primers. The key is to select products specifically designed for biohazard and decomposition odors, as regular air fresheners or deodorizers will only provide temporary masking.

  • Is professional blood cleanup covered by insurance?

    In many cases, homeowner or property insurance policies cover the cost of professional blood cleanup. Its advisable to check with your insurance provider to understand your coverage and any necessary documentation.
